Job DescriptionThe Role: We are currently seeking to recruit a Procurement and Vendor Manager to join our Global Technology Services (GTS) team in London. This is an exciting role for someone with drive and enthusiasm to be involved in the commercial management of projects and monitoring third party performance. The Procurement and Vendor Manager is responsible for managing contracts and relationships with third party vendors to ensure compliance, cost efficiency and alignment to the business objectives. This role involves negotiating contracts, monitoring vendor performance and mitigating risks.

Responsibilities

Oversee the end-to-end procurement process, from requisition to payment

Develop, issue and manage Requests for Proposal (RFPs)

Develop, review, negotiate and manage vendor contracts in accordance with company policies

Ensure contract terms align with business objectives and mitigate risks effectively

Work closely with business teams to understand the appropriate terms and conditions of contracts

Ensure that contract requirements are resolved in appropriate timeframes

Collaborate effectively with legal, risk and finance teams to ensure compliance to company policy and procedures

Continuous review and monitoring of contract changes and identify gaps and improvement opportunities

Monitor vendor performance against SLAs and KPIs

Conduct regular vendor reviews to ensure adherence to contract terms and company guidelines

Build strong relationships with vendors to enhance service quality, cost effectiveness and continuous improvement

Drive process improvements to enhance operational efficiencies and reduce vendor related risks

Undertake other responsibilities as required for the proper performance of the role

Skills / ExperienceEssential

8+ years of experience in contract and vendor management, preferably within the financial services sector

Strong knowledge and experience in contract and vendor life-cycle management, contract negotiation and managing vendor relationships

Excellent analytical, problem solving and decision-making skills

Strong communication and stakeholder management abilities

Exceptional attention to detail

Desirable

Experience in the re-insurance industry would be desirable but other industries would be considered

Contract related certification preferred – IACCM and/or CIPS
